Patent number: 5292965Abstract: Radiation curable compositions containing outstanding reactive diluents have been developed. The diluents are lower alkyl ether acrylates and methacrylates of particular alkoxylated and non-alkoxylated polyols.Examples are mono-methoxy trimethylolpropane diacrylate, mono-methoxy neopentyl glycol monoacrylate and mono-methoxy, ethoxylated neopentyl glycol monoacrylate having an average of about two moles of ethylene oxide.Type: GrantFiled: June 14, 1993Date of Patent: March 8, 1994Assignee: Diamond Shamrock Chemicals CompanyInventors: Francis A. Higbie, Robert A. LieBerman, Rose Ira M.

Patent number: 4814389Abstract: An aqueous drilling fluid having present in an amount sufficient to disperse the fluid and to provide resistance to high temperatures and solids contamination of the drilling fluid, at least one salt of a polymer or copolymer of acrylic or methacrylic acid with alkanolamine, alkylamine, mixtures of alkanolamine and alkylamine, mixtures of lithium and alkanolamine, mixtures of lithium and alkylamine and mixtures of lithium, alkanolamine and alkylamine, the polymer having a weight average molecular weight of between about 2,000 and about 15,000 and a pH of from about 6 to about 8.5 and where mixtures of lithium and alkanolamine, lithium and alkylamine or mixtures of lithium, alkanolamine and alkylamine are used, the amount of lithium is present to give from about 30% to about 70% of the desired neutralization of the polymer and the alkanolamine and/or alkylamine is present to give from about 70% to about 30% of the desired neutralization of the polymer.Type: GrantFiled: July 8, 1987Date of Patent: March 21, 1989Assignee: Diamond Shamrock Chemicals CompanyInventors: Christopher M. Garvey, Arpad Savoly, Thomas M. Weatherford

Patent number: 4810328Abstract: An improved method of brown stock washing is disclosed. A nonionic surfactant in combination with a polyelectrolyte dispersant, and preferably a solvent, are utilized in the washing step in the pulping of virgin cellulosic fiber. The methods of the invention provide for the enhanced removal and recovery of cooking chemicals and organics from the pulp.Type: GrantFiled: November 4, 1987Date of Patent: March 7, 1989Assignee: Diamond Shamrock Chemicals CompanyInventors: Richard E. Freis, James E. Maloney, Thomas R. Oakes

Patent number: 4800229Abstract: Reactive dispersants for magnetic recording media are prepared by sequentially phosphating and esterifying or esterifying and phosphating alkoxylated alcohols having at least two carbon atoms and at least two hydroxyl groups. The phosphating agent can be phosphorus oxychloride while the esterifying agent can be acrylic acid.Type: GrantFiled: January 12, 1988Date of Patent: January 24, 1989Assignee: Diamond Shamrock Chemical CompanyInventor: John G. Papalos

Patent number: 4744795Abstract: The present invention relates to coal water slurries containing about 0.01% to 1% by weight of a water soluble terpolymer of ethylacrylate/methacrylic acid/ unsaturated carboxylic acid ester of an ethoxylated or nonethoxylated alcohol or an ethoxylated carboxylic acid.The water soluble terpolymer functions as a stablizing agent for the coal water slurry to prevent sedimentation and provide ease of pumping the coal water slurry.The water soluble terpolymer may be used alone or in combination with anionic or nonionic dispersants.Type: GrantFiled: August 21, 1986Date of Patent: May 17, 1988Assignee: Diamond Shamrock Chemicals CompanyInventors: Arpad Savoly, Jose L. Villa, Reuben H. Grinstein, Solomon J. Nachfolger

Patent number: 4742105Abstract: Binary mixtures of polyacrylates and sodium silicates are used as deflocculating agents for kaolin slurries to ensure pumpability and pourability of the slurry. An example of a binary mixture is a mixture of 67% by weight sodium polyacrylate having a weight average molecular weight of 4,200 and 33% by weight of sodium silicate on a dry solids basis.Type: GrantFiled: May 29, 1986Date of Patent: May 3, 1988Assignee: Diamond Shamrock Chemicals CompanyInventor: Edwin L. Kelley

Patent number: 4699225Abstract: Polymers of (1) from about 5% to about 50% by weight of 2-acrylamido-2-methylpropane sulfonic acid and (2) from about 95% to about 50% by weight of a second component, there being from 100% to about 80% by weight acrylic acid and from 0% to about 20% by weight of itaconic acid in the second component and having a weight average molecular weight of between about 50,000 to about 1,000,000 and which are at least water dispersible are used as fluid loss control additives for aqueous drilling fluids and are particularly advantageous when used with muds containing soluble calcium ions and muds containing chloride ions such as seawater muds. An example is a copolymer of 10% by weight 2-acrylamido-2-methylpropane sulfonic acid and 90% by weight acrylic acid in its sodium salt form.Type: GrantFiled: November 7, 1985Date of Patent: October 13, 1987Assignee: Diamond Shamrock Chemicals CompanyInventor: Dinshaw F. Bardoliwalla

Patent number: 4696981Abstract: Homopolyamino acids and copolyamino acids are prepared by polycondensation of one kind or a mixture of two or more kinds of monoammonium, diammonium, monoamide, diamide or monoamideammonium salts of malic acid and/or maleic acid and/or fumaric acid, one kind or two or more kinds of amino acid being added to said raw materials, respectively, with application of microwaves, the resulting polyamino acids (imide type) being converted to peptide type, homopolyamino acids and copolyamino acids, respectively upon partial hydrolysis. The operation involved in the reaction is simple and the method permits the use of low cost reaction materials. As a result, imide type and also peptide type, homopolyamino and copolyamino acids are produced with uniform quality at a high rate of yield within an extremely short period of time. Accordingly, the method is incomparably superior to those which have been announced in the past.Type: GrantFiled: March 13, 1986Date of Patent: September 29, 1987Assignee: Diamond Shamrock Chemicals CompanyInventors: Kaoru Harada, Akira Shimoyama, Hiroji Mizumoto

Patent number: 4674574Abstract: Cementing compositions and methods of using such compositions in oil, gas and water well cementing operations to reduce fluid loss from the composition to the formation are disclosed. Such compositions incorporate a terpolymer formed from (a) an acid monomer selected from the group consisting of 2-acrylamido, 2-methyl propane sulfonic acid (AMPS), sodium vinyl sulfonate or vinyl benzene sulfonate, and metal salts thereof at about 10 to 75 weight percent in the polymer; (b) an unsaturated polybasic acid such as itaconic acid at about 1 to 60 weight percent; and metal salts thereof and (c) a nonionic monomer selected from the group consisting of acrylamide, N, N dimethylacrylamide, N-vinyl pyrrolidone, N-vinyl acetamide, or dimethylamino ethyl methacrylate and metal salts thereof at about 10 to 76 weight percent. The terpolymer should have a molecular weight between 200,000 to 1,000,000. The preferred terpolymer comprise AMPS, acrylamide and itaconic acid.Type: GrantFiled: September 26, 1986Date of Patent: June 23, 1987Assignee: Diamond Shamrock Chemicals CompanyInventors: Arpad Savoly, Jose L. Villa, Christopher M. Garvey, Albert L. Resnick

Patent number: 4647384Abstract: Copolymers of (1) from about 80% to about 98% by weight of acrylic acid and (2) from about 2% to about 20% by weight of itaconic acid and having a weight average molecular weight of between about 50,000 to about 1,000,000, preferably between about 100,000 to about 500,000, and which are at least water dispersible, are used as fluid loss control additives for aqueous drilling fluids and are particularly advantageous when used with muds containing soluble calcium and muds containing chloride ions such as seawater muds. An example is a copolymer of 95% by weight acrylic acid and 5% by weight itaconic acid in its sodium salt form.Type: GrantFiled: November 12, 1985Date of Patent: March 3, 1987Assignee: Diamond Shamrock Chemicals CompanyInventors: Dinshaw F. Bardoliwalla, Jose L. Villa

Patent number: 4643800Abstract: The method of substantially removing and dispersing resinous or waxy contaminants from contaminant-containing secondary fiber during repulping, is disclosed. The method includes combining the contaminant-containing secondary fiber in an aqueous repulping medium with a substituted oxyethylene glycol nonionic surfactant, and a water soluble, low molecular weight polyelectrolyte dispersant, at an elevated temperature.Type: GrantFiled: June 7, 1985Date of Patent: February 17, 1987Assignee: Diamond Shamrock Chemicals CompanyInventors: James F. Maloney, Richard E. Freis, Thomas R. Oakes

Patent number: 4634451Abstract: Aqueous carbonaceous mixtures such as water slurries of solid particulate carbonaceous materials having reduced viscosity, a stabilized network of carbonaceous materials in water and improved pumpability are obtained by using a condensation product of an aldehyde in aldehyde liberating composition, ketone and sulfur dioxide in a sulfur dioxide liberating composition as dispersant, the dispersant being present in an amount sufficient to reduce viscosity of the slurry, stabilize the network of carbonaceous materials in water and improve pumpability. An improved process for the condensation product is disclosed.Type: GrantFiled: May 10, 1985Date of Patent: January 6, 1987Assignee: Diamond Shamrock Chemicals CompanyInventors: Stanley A. Lipowski, Jose L. Villa, John J. Miskel, Jr., Reuben H. Grinstein
